Lake Toba Festival: Celebrating Nature and Batak Culture

Danau Toba Sumatera Utara BATIQA Hotels - Sumber foto Istock

Who hasn't heard of Lake Toba? Located in North Sumatra, this is the largest volcanic lake in the world, and it’s not just a stunning sight but also a hub of rich culture and tradition. One of the best ways to experience the charm of Lake Toba is by attending the Lake Toba Festival, a celebration that will surely captivate your heart and soul!

Held around Lake Toba, the festival typically spans several days filled with vibrant events. You can enjoy amazing art performances, from traditional Batak dances to soul-stirring music performances. The colorful and energetic atmosphere of the festival is bound to leave you mesmerized!

One of the main attractions of the Lake Toba Festival is the showcase of local wisdom. Visitors can witness various aspects of Batak culture, including delicious traditional foods, unique handicrafts, and meaningful cultural rituals. Don’t miss the chance to taste authentic Batak dishes like saksang or Batak fried rice, which will surely delight your taste buds.

The festival also features a variety of exciting competitions and contests. From traditional boat races to sports events involving the local community, this is a golden opportunity to experience camaraderie and the vibrant spirit of the Lake Toba region.

The Lake Toba Festival is not just about entertainment; it’s also about preserving culture. By participating in this festival, you contribute to maintaining and promoting the rich Batak heritage. It’s an experience that is not only entertaining but also educational and inspiring.
